>> Hello,
>> I have a spacewalk 2.4 server running on RHEL 6 Server, with PGSQL 8.4
>> local database.
>> I have several repository syncs scheduled during the night.
>> I've noticed that since the 2.4 upgrade, if a first schedule is still
>> running when a second is supposed to be launch, this second repository
>> sync is simply skipped and never launched, even when schedule 1 is
>> completed.
>> For exemple:
>> Centos 6 Base scheduled at 8pm
>> Centos 7 Base scheduled at 8.30pm
>> If centos 6 base hasn't been ended before 8.30pm, centos 7 Base is
>> simply skipped.
>>
>> I'm pretty sure that before 2.4 upgrade, the second schedule was
>> launched as soon as the first one ended.
>>
>> Am I totally wrong? If so, how can I configure spacewalk to be sure that
>> each reposync are lunched each night?

> Hello,
>
> this bug has been fixed and updated spacewalk-java packages for 2.4
> version should be in the repo. Please try to update.
